From a global perspective, almost every person living in America could be considered wealthy. America has so much wealth inside her borders that for those fortunate to live within them can be left feeling poor because they aren’t quite as wealthy as the perceive others to be. I think we sometimes see this idea within the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ints. Most Saints, from a global perspective, are brilliant, successful, and worthy. However, because there is so much good within the ranks of the church, it is possible to believe that we aren’t quite as adequate, worthy or secure as other saints, often because we are comparing ourselves to some of the finest men and women our world has to offer. Comparison is rarely productive, but of these two options, lets adopt the bigger picture perspective and realize that if we are saints, we are almost certainly succeeding.
